Transaction 34d3eeae247e932b4596f186870fa58604fa5f689022edf59fc31f46f5558eb2

1 Input
2 Outputs
  • 34d3eeae247e932b4596f186870fa58604fa5f689022edf59fc31f46f5558eb2:0
  • value  1700000
    address  3BXGhr6roR2A6BoefmnUiSyYUinVEtmpAd
  • 34d3eeae247e932b4596f186870fa58604fa5f689022edf59fc31f46f5558eb2:1
  • value  108477414
    address  32MLHpP3BK1m5RrWSkZ596sKqwESLwWyE6